  1. Let's start with the first change: if you're aspiring to become a morning person, try placing your alarm clock on the opposite end of your bedroom. This simple shift forces you to physically get out of bed to turn off the alarm, effectively discouraging the snooze button temptation that often disrupts our morning routines. By starting your day with this proactive approach, you set a positive tone for the rest of your day.
  2. Change number two is all about work-life balance. Make it a habit to add one personal item to your daily to-do list, alongside work-related tasks. This ensures that you prioritize personal matters and don't neglect the essential aspects of life that truly matter. Balancing professional responsibilities with personal needs can lead to a more fulfilled and contented life.
  3. Next, create an email folder labeled "praise" and save positive feedback from clients or bosses in it. This seemingly small action not only boosts your confidence during moments of self-doubt but also provides valuable testimonials that you can refer to in the future. This folder becomes a treasure trove of evidence showcasing your capabilities and accomplishments.
  4. Another vital change is to carry a water bottle with you everywhere you go. This simple act serves as a constant reminder to stay hydrated, which is crucial for your overall health and well-being. Additionally, having a water bottle readily available can help curb unnecessary snacking by keeping you more satisfied and less inclined to reach for unhealthy snacks.
  5. In relationships, make a conscious effort never to go to bed angry at your partner. Resolve conflicts before sleeping to prevent issues from escalating and potentially damaging the relationship over time. Addressing disagreements and finding resolutions before bedtime fosters open communication and strengthens the emotional bond between partners.
  6. When it comes to healthy eating, consider investing in high-quality, low-processed organic food whenever possible. This ensures that you nourish your body with the best possible ingredients, promoting better health and well-being. Additionally, limiting the presence of junk food at home helps to avoid temptation and encourages making healthier dietary choices.
  7. To enhance productivity and focus during work hours, keep your phone on silent and place it upside down. By doing this, you minimize distractions and interruptions, enabling you to be more efficient and engaged with your tasks. This practice can significantly boost your overall productivity throughout the day.
  8. Another helpful habit is to write out a physical to-do list before bedtime and place it next to your alarm clock. This act serves as a powerful motivation tool, as it gives you a clear sense of purpose and direction upon waking up. The to-do list acts as a visual reminder of your tasks, helping you stay organized and accomplish your goals more effectively.
  9. Lastly, allocate at least 10 minutes every day to be still and quiet. Whether through meditation, taking a mindful walk, or listening to calming music, these moments of tranquility can bring peace and appreciation to your life. Embracing these pockets of serenity allows you to recharge, reduce stress, and gain clarity in your thoughts, ultimately enhancing your overall well-being.
